Biological Engineering programme at the UMinho celebrates 30 years with an activity programme throughout the year.
The commemoration activities of the 30th anniversary of the Biological Engineering programme at the University of Minho were launched on the 22nd October, at the campus of Gualtar, in Braga. To highlight the three decades, the Department of Biological Engineering (DEB) and the Centre of Biological Engineering (CEB) of the EEUM prepared a set of activities, evoking the event and seeking to foster interaction between former and current students, faculty and representatives from partner institutions and industry which received programme graduates or have cooperated with the Department in several moments.

The programme includes the Biological Engineering Days, from the 23rd to the 25th November, and the Science and Technology Week, also in November. In May 2017, a Job and Entrepreneurship Fair of Biological Engineering will take place, creating an opportunity for exchanging contacts and experiences, disseminating the programme’s and its students’ quality and presenting companies/businesses created by former student along the last 30 years.

The Biological Engineering degree was the first to be created in Portugal in this knowledge area, on the 5th July 1985, through the governmental decree 420/85. The first edition started in September 1986. Currently, the programme is taught as an integrated master programme and counts on more than 1.100 graduates (bachelor and master level). Many former students are presently employed by renowned companies and public institutions, either in Portugal or abroad.

The Biological Engineering programme aims at training professionals for several industries and services, thus preparing them to be part of working areas related to biological, environmental, chemical or physical-chemical processes. As far as industry sectors, former students of Biological Engineering have been integrated in services and industries in agro-food, pharmaceutical, cellulose, chemical, waste water, safety and quality control or environmental consultancy areas.
